This paper deals with the problem of allocating bits and power among a set of parallel frequency-flat subchannels. The objective is to maximize the number of information bits delivered without error to the user by unit of time, or good-put. We consider a frame-oriented transmission with convolutional coding, hard Viterbi decoding, and selective repeat automatic repeat request (ARQ) retransmission protocol. An expression for the goodput of the considered communication system is derived. Different bit and power allocations strategies are proposed and compared to one another using simulations. It turns out that the best trade-off between performance and complexity is achieved by allocating the power in such a way that the bit error rate is equal on all subchannels, and by allocating the bits by rounding the solution to the problem obtained by relaxing the constraint of integer constellation sizes. © 2007 EURASIP.
